pycharm调用docker容器环境_51CTO博客
场景介绍很多时候我们部署一个东西到服务器上的时候,难免会污染已有环境,尤其某个东西比较复杂我们需要反复测试时此时我们很自然的想到,在服务器上部署一个容器解决问题,如果是正常流程我们应该写Dockerfile构建容器,但是我们想更快,更方便思路很简单,启动一个CentOS7镜像,如有必要这个镜像我们甚至能够直接启动到生产服务器上去,这个镜像一般暴露2个端口足够,一个用来SSH通信,一个对外提供自身的
# PyCharm调用Docker环境 ## 简介 在软件开发中,Docker是一种常用的容器化技术,可以将应用程序及其依赖项打包成一个方便部署的独立单元。而PyCharm是一款功能强大的Python集成开发环境,它提供了很多便捷的功能来提高开发效率。本文将介绍如何在PyCharm调用Docker环境,以便在开发过程中使用容器化的服务。 ## 流程图 下面是整个过程的流程图: ```m
原创 2023-10-07 06:15:22
40阅读
默认已经安装了:docker(并下载好所需要的环境的image镜像)pycharm专业版步骤:创建docker的container image和container的关系,类似于类和实例之间的关系。所以这一步是利用image实例化一个container$ docker run -p 10022:22 --runtime=nvidia --ipc=host --name your_container_
目录前言一、准备工作二、为docker镜像配置ssh-server三、将本地目录映射到docker容器中四、将pycharmdocker容器相链接前言本文中,将详细讲述如何使用pycharm调用docker中的python环境,并处理宿主机(本地)中的文件。一、准备工作本文所需要的工具如下1.pycharm(专业版),只有专业版才支持ssh链接进行调试,而本文中pycharmdocker容器
# 使用 PyCharmDocker 容器环境进行开发 在现代软件开发中,Docker 已经成为一种流行的工具,它能帮助开发者快速搭建、测试和部署应用。而 PyCharm 作为一款强大的 Python IDE,提供了出色的 Docker 集成功能。这使得开发者可以在隔离的环境中进行开发,避免了环境不一致带来的问题。 ## 什么是 DockerDocker 是一个开放源代码的容器化平
原创 3月前
4阅读
要求: pycharm为专业版,docker容器的ssh服务是开启的,并且开放了22端口,与远程主机绑定了端口 如果docker容器是通过docker comnpose启动的,也要开启相关服务。 这里就以docker compose 中的容器进行演示开放端口在docker-compose.yml配置文件中需要绑定22端口号ports: - '33:22' # 主机的33端口
转载 9月前
101阅读
# PyCharm连接Docker容器Python环境 ## 介绍 PyCharm是一款流行的Python集成开发环境(IDE),它提供了丰富的功能和工具,使得Python开发变得更加高效和便捷。在开发过程中,我们经常需要配置和使用不同的Python环境Docker是一个开源的容器化平台,可以帮助我们创建和管理轻量级的容器。本文将介绍如何在PyCharm中连接Docker容器的Python环
原创 2023-07-20 10:44:27
848阅读
简述问题最近项目在使用yolov8,我个人习惯在pycharm中的console中逐行测试代码,但在pycharm的console中执行yolov8的示例代码报了完全看不懂的错误 具体的报错信息 报错代码Traceback (most recent call last): File "<string>", line 1, in <module> File "D:\p
转载 1月前
8阅读
网上一些博客也有关于Pycharm远程连接服务器的内容,但是他们说的方法大多需要deployment设置和interpreter配置两步,稍微有点繁琐,根据我的实践经历,只需要interpreter配置这一个步骤就可以,因为在这一步中只要设置好sync folders,就pycharm自动做好了deployment,也就能够实现文件传输与同步。下面开始介绍Pycharm远程连接服务器(或者dock
# 在 PyCharm 中配置 Docker 容器环境的指南 在现代软件开发中,Docker 容器化已成为一种流行的技术。它帮助开发者在轻量级的环境中快速构建、测试和部署应用程序。当我们使用 PyCharm 作为 Python 开发工具时,可以很方便地将 Docker 容器作为解释器进行配置。本文将详细介绍如何在 PyCharm 中配置本地 Docker 容器环境,包括一些代码示例和可视化图表来
原创 3月前
112阅读
目录一. Nvidia-docker二. Nvidia-docker21. 安装nvidia-docker22. nvidia-gpu-plugin安装3. 容器中运行TensorFlow一. Nvidia-dockernvidia-docker是一个可以使用GPU的docker,在Docker基础上做了一成封装目前为止,已发布发布两个大的稳定版本,其中nvidia-docker已经被弃用,本次做
文章目录一、远程服务器以及本地pycharm配置1 原理2 ssh配置步骤3 本地pycharm配置二、使用中的问题1 在使用pycharm调试程序的时候,无法连接到控制台,程序无法运行 一、远程服务器以及本地pycharm配置1 原理将docker中的ssh端口22映射到服务器中的某一个端口,例如9999,本地使用docker的用户名和密码登录9999端口,也就登录了相应的docker2 ss
转载 2023-09-23 17:13:07
246阅读
# PyCharm容器Docker 在软件开发领域,PyCharm是一款备受开发者喜爱的集成开发环境,而Docker则是一种轻量级的虚拟化技术,能够实现快速部署、管理和扩展应用程序。将PyCharmDocker结合起来,可以为开发者提供更加灵活、高效的开发环境。本文将介绍如何在PyCharm中使用Docker容器,以及如何利用这种组合来进行开发。 ## Docker简介 Docker是一种
原创 6月前
13阅读
# 实现 PyCharm Docker 环境的步骤 ## 1. 确保你已经安装了以下软件和工具: - PyCharm:集成开发环境,用于开发 Python 项目。 - Docker容器化平台,用于将应用程序和其依赖项打包为容器。 ## 2. 创建 Dockerfile 首先,我们需要创建一个 Dockerfile,它用于定义 Docker 镜像的构建过程。 ```dockerfile
原创 10月前
239阅读
最近看了《Docker——从入门到实践》对docker有了些基本的了解,看到pycharmdocker的配置选项,就打算试一下用docker部署Flask开发环境的想法。首先检查是否具备基本的部署条件PyCharm 必须是2017.1或更高的专业版已经安装了DockerDocker-compose,打开终端并运行docker -v和docker-compose -v创建Flask项目使用PyC
PyCharm配置Dockerpycharm中直接:File–>settting,然后新建一个docker,里面的 什么配置都不用变,它自动会找到你的所有容器然后在左下角直接run起来最后在解释器中选择你想用的docker容器就可以了怎么访问docker容器中的文件一、可以将docker中的文件copy出来,处理完再copy回去,具体操作如下:1、如何从docker容器中下载文件:dock
转载 2023-08-31 22:00:08
357阅读
  使用pycharm远程调试docker里的python程序时间:20210810,版本:0.1,ROBOTECH_ERX 一个放在docker里的python程序,分析一下实现原理,需要搭建调试环境单步调试。镜像是一个ubuntu 16 lts,镜像中的python环境管理使用的是virtualenv+virtualenvwrapper。本地环境是ubuntu20
本篇博客主要介绍了docker的配置,以及利用Pycharm作为开发平台连接远程服务器进行开发,在中途遇到了一些问题,作为记录且方便有同样问题的同学进行参考。docker的安装及开放首先在ubuntu上安装docker,命令如下:cur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un由于服务器上已预先安装好docker
在上一篇《手把手陪您学Python》2——Python的安装,我们一起安装了Anaconda,计算机中就具备了运行Python的环境。这一篇中,我们将一起安装Python的集成开发环境PyCharm,之后大家就可以正式编写运行Python程序了。PyCharm也可以从官网(https://www.jetbrains.com/pycharm/download/)中免费下载。虽然PyCharm也有收费
转载 2023-09-06 22:55:17
91阅读
文章目录前言一、Ubuntu离线安装docker二、dockerhub下载合适镜像三、配置docker容器1.运行容器2.给容器安装openssh-server和openssh-client3.vim打开并修改配置文件4.创建docker中root用户的密码:5.重启ssh服务6.确认docker容器内python位置7.测试是否映射成功8.生成新的镜像9.导出镜像10.导入镜像四、配置pych
  • 1
  • 2
  • 3
  • 4
  • 5